This page lists 12 hotels in Asheville with charging data, all offering Level 2 charging. Nine show free charging for guests; the rest list paid or flat-rate charging. Networks named here include Tesla, ChargePoint, and unspecified in-house setups. Nightly rates run from $94 to $427, so you have options across the price range.
None of the listings here show DC fast charging on site, so plan overnight Level 2 charging rather than a quick top-off before you leave.
Asheville sits in the Blue Ridge Mountains and is the gateway to the Blue Ridge Parkway, a scenic drive that stretches north and south from town. The Biltmore Estate and a walkable downtown draw most visitors, and mountain day trips like Chimney Rock and Mount Mitchell stay within a single charge. Fall leaf season brings heavy traffic, so charge overnight and start early.

Booking sites get charging wrong often enough that we don't take it from them. Every charger here is mapped from a public registry and tied to the property itself.
National charger registries, filtered to hotels, are the backbone of every listing.
A charger counts only when it sits at the hotel: within 60 metres, or 150 with a matching name.
Every listing shows the month we last updated it. Anything unconfirmed is left off, never guessed.
Albemarle Inn, a Select Registry Property, Best Western Asheville-Blue Ridge Parkway, Cambria Hotel Downtown Asheville, DoubleTree by Hilton Asheville Downtown, GLo Hotel Asheville-Blue Ridge Parkway and 2 more list Tesla destination charging. Non-Tesla EVs need a NACS adapter for these, and access is often guests-only, so confirm at booking.
